
Background
World of Warcraft: Dragonflight brought the Dracthyr Evoker to the forefront. Dracthyr are a race created by Neltharion, designed as the ultimate soldiers blending the essence of all dragonflights. The Evoker class, unique to Dracthyr, channels draconic power to devastate foes or mend allies. They were meant to be protectors under the Earth-Warder’s command.
Evokers can deal damage as a ranged damage dealer or heal as a support role. They favor mail armor and can wield a variety of weapons, including daggers, staves, and one-handed weapons (though no dual-wielding). Their unique heritage grants them inherent dragonriding skills, allowing them to soar through the Dragon Isles without needing a traditional mount.
Dracthyr offer faction flexibility, choosing to align with either the Alliance or the Horde. Their origin story is deeply tied to the Dragon Isles, adding a rich layer of lore to their gameplay. Overview
The Evoker is a Hero Class, meaning players can only create one if they already have a level 50 or higher character on the realm. Dracthyr Evokers begin their journey at level 58, skipping the earlier leveling process and jumping directly into Dragonflight content. This makes them a quick way to explore the new expansion.
Each server is limited to one Evoker character, adding a layer of exclusivity to the class. Their adventure starts in the Forbidden Reach, a unique starting zone located north-northwest of the Eastern Kingdoms. This area serves as an introduction to their powers and the events leading up to the Dragonflight expansion.
The class offers two specializations at launch: Devastation (damage) and Preservation (healing). This focused design allows for deep specialization and distinct playstyles. The Evoker uses a resource called Essence, which regenerates over time, fueling their powerful draconic abilities.
Specializations
The Devastation specialization is all about dealing damage from a medium range. These Evokers use the combined might of the red and blue dragonflights to unleash fiery explosions and precise arcane blasts. They are mobile spellcasters, able to weave in and out of combat while delivering substantial damage.
Preservation Evokers focus on healing, utilizing the essence of the green and bronze dragonflights. Green magic provides powerful area-of-effect healing, while bronze magic manipulates time to accelerate healing and reverse detrimental effects. They have a shorter range than typical healers, but make up for it with increased mobility and potent healing output.
Evokers draw upon the power of all the dragonflights, allowing them to adapt to various situations. This versatility is reflected in their talent trees, which offer diverse options for customizing their playstyle. Tips for Leveling
Starting Location
The Forbidden Reach provides a compelling narrative focused on the origins of the Dracthyr. Players will uncover Neltharion’s experiments and the reasons for the Dracthyr’s long slumber. This zone teaches the basics of the Evoker class and introduces their unique mechanics.
Like other Hero classes, the Forbidden Reach offers a streamlined leveling experience. Players gradually unlock abilities and upgrade their gear as they progress through the zone. They will also learn to utilize their Soar ability, allowing for fast and efficient travel across the islands.
After completing the Forbidden Reach storyline, Dracthyr are sent to either Stormwind City (Alliance) or Orgrimmar (Horde) to begin their Dragonflight adventure. This transition marks their integration into the wider world of Azeroth and the start of their journey to protect the Dragon Isles.
Devastation Evoker
Managing cooldowns effectively is crucial for Devastation Evokers. Prepare for large pulls when Dragonrage is about to become available to maximize its impact. Use defensive cooldowns like Obsidian Scales and Renewing Blaze proactively to mitigate incoming damage.
Don’t be afraid to pull multiple enemies at once. Devastation Evokers excel at dealing area-of-effect damage, making them efficient at clearing groups of mobs. Experiment with your abilities and learn how to maximize your damage output in different scenarios.
Utilize your mobility to create distance when needed. The Evoker’s ability to heal themselves and quickly reposition allows them to recover from dangerous situations. Use Visage Form outside of combat for passive healing while exploring.
Preservation Evoker
Utilize crowd control abilities like Tail Swipe, Wing Buffet, Quell, and Azure Strike frequently to manage enemies effectively. Slowing and interrupting enemies can significantly improve your survivability and the group’s overall safety.
Prioritize dealing damage whenever possible. Use global cooldowns to contribute to the group’s damage output while still maintaining healing. When low on health, use efficient spells like Verdant Embrace or Living Flame to quickly recover.
Exercise caution when dealing with strong enemies. It’s often better to take on challenging mobs one at a time, using defensive cooldowns like Obsidian Scales to survive. Choose your battles wisely and prioritize your own survival.
Consider enabling War Mode for increased experience gains, but be aware of the increased risk of PvP combat. Team up with friends for greater security when leveling in War Mode.
Empowered Spells
Empowered Spells are a unique mechanic exclusive to the Evoker class. These spells require the player to hold down the key, increasing the spell’s power the longer it’s charged. This allows for a dynamic playstyle where players can choose the intensity of their spells based on the situation.
Players can customize how Empowered Spells are cast through the Gameplay-Controls menu. The “Hold and Release” method requires holding the key down to charge and releasing to cast, while the “Press and Tap” method charges with the first press and casts with a second tap. Both options provide a visual charge bar to indicate the spell’s power level.
While charging an Empowered Spell, players can adjust their facing to aim the spell. However, moving forward or backward will cancel the charging process. This adds a tactical element to casting, requiring players to carefully position themselves before unleashing their empowered abilities.
